Paul's Story

At the end of my junior year i was denied re-entry to HolyCross by Sister Hilda. When i think back on that i wished it had been me who beaned her with the snow ball! Well ladies an gents fellow alumni i ended up going to Caesar Rodney which i disliked very much. I had 21 credits already with the 3 classes i had to take in the morning an filled my afternoons with VoTech. After high school i messed around for a couple of yrs (being i wasnt college material) an went into the USAF. I served for 8 years lived in San Antonio, Texas for 6 years an Wiesbaden, Germany for 2 years. I worked as an telephone cable splicer. After i got out, i went to work as a line cook in lewes Delaware for 2 years then in Dover at a few restaurants and then in Wesley College. I got transferred to Lycoming College in Williamsport Pa in Oct. 1985. Worked there for about 6 months then quit an worked a Italian restaurants for the next 28 years. During that time i married a woman that already had 4 kids, 3 lived with us for the next 10 years. In my 10th year of marriage i had to have my right leg amputated because of an infection i had. My wife divorced me because she considered me to be handicapped. I continued to work after i got my prosthetic leg an did so for another 11 years until i had my other leg amputated.
